Effect of combined noise and dust on ECG and blood pressure of calcium carbonate processing staff
Objective To investigate the effects of combined noise and dust on ECG and blood pressure in calcium carbonate processing workers.Methods From January to June 2022,907 workers in the calcium carbonate processing industry exposed to dust or noise and 482 administrators without dust or noise exposure in Hezhou City were selected as the study subjects.The physical examination information of the subjects was collect and the impact of noise combined with dust on ECG and blood pressure of workers in calcium carbonate processing industry was analyzed.Results The incidence of abnormal ECG and abnormal blood pressure of related personnel in calcium carbonate processing industry(12.97%and 20.84%)was greatly higher than that of administrative personnel without dust and noise exposure(5.60%and 11.20%)(both P<0.05).The results of single factor analysis showed that the occurrence of abnormal ECG and abnormal blood pressure of relevant personnel in calcium carbonate processing industry were affected by gender,age,body mass index,working years and occupational exposure types of practitioners(all P<0.05).In addition,abnormal blood pressure was also affected by smoking and drinking among staff(P<0.05).The results of multivariate logistic regression analysis showed that compared with the workers in calcium carbonate processing industry exposed to dust alone,the workers exposed to noise and dust had a higher risk of abnormal ECG(OR=4.728,95%CI:1.857-12.102)and higher risk of abnormal blood pressure(OR=5.076,95%CI:3.348-7.695).Conclusion Both the simple dust effect and the combined effect of noise and dust will affect the ECG and blood pressure related to calcium carbonate processing industry,and the combined effect of noise and dust is more significant.
